Secure Shell (SSH) is a network protocol that enables secure communication between devices over an unsecured network. With SSH, you can connect to your Raspberry Pi from any location as long as you have an internet connection.

    SSH provides a command-line interface for interacting with your Raspberry Pi. This is particularly useful if your device doesn't have a monitor or keyboard connected. By enabling SSH, you can execute commands, transfer files, and manage your system remotely.

    Setting Up SSH on Raspberry Pi

    Before you can access your Raspberry Pi remotely, you need to enable SSH on the device. Here's how you can do it:

    Enable SSH via Raspberry Pi Configuration

    1. Open the Raspberry Pi Configuration tool by typing sudo raspi-config in the terminal.
    2. Select the "Interfacing Options" menu.
    3. Choose "SSH" and enable it.
    4. Reboot your Raspberry Pi to apply the changes.

    Enable SSH via Filesystem

    If you don't have access to the Raspberry Pi's terminal, you can enable SSH by adding an empty file named "ssh" to the boot partition of your SD card.

    Securing Your SSH Connection

    Security is paramount when using SSH. Follow these best practices to protect your Raspberry Pi:

    Change the Default SSH Port

    By default, SSH runs on port 22. Changing this to a non-standard port can reduce the risk of automated attacks.

    Disable Root Login

    Disallowing root login via SSH adds an extra layer of security. You can do this by editing the SSH configuration file:

    1. Open the file using sudo nano /etc/ssh/sshd_config.
    2. Set PermitRootLogin to "no".
    3. Restart the SSH service with sudo systemctl restart ssh.

    Use Key-Based Authentication

    Instead of relying on passwords, use SSH keys for authentication. This method is more secure and convenient.

    Understanding Port Forwarding

    Port forwarding allows you to access your Raspberry Pi from outside your local network. Here's how you can set it up:

    Access Your Router Settings

    Log in to your router's admin interface and navigate to the port forwarding section. Create a new rule that maps an external port to your Raspberry Pi's internal IP address and SSH port.

    Dynamic IP Addresses

    Most internet service providers assign dynamic IP addresses. To ensure consistent access, consider using a dynamic DNS service.

    Dynamic DNS (DDNS) for Remote Access

    A dynamic DNS service updates your domain name to reflect your current IP address. Some popular DDNS providers include:

    • No-IP
    • DuckDNS
    • FreeDNS

    These services are often free and easy to set up. Follow the provider's instructions to configure your Raspberry Pi for DDNS.

    Common Issues and Troubleshooting

    Even with careful setup, issues can arise. Here are some common problems and their solutions:

    Connection Refused

    This error usually indicates a problem with port forwarding or firewall settings. Double-check your router configuration and ensure that SSH is enabled on your Raspberry Pi.

    Permission Denied (Public Key)

    If you're using key-based authentication, ensure that your public key is correctly added to the ~/.ssh/authorized_keys file on your Raspberry Pi.

    Timeout Errors

    Timeout errors may occur if your Raspberry Pi's IP address has changed. Verify that your DDNS service is functioning correctly.

    Alternative Solutions for Remote Access

    While SSH is a powerful tool, other solutions can also provide remote access to your Raspberry Pi:

    VNC (Virtual Network Computing)

    VNC allows you to access your Raspberry Pi's graphical interface remotely. This is useful if you need to interact with the desktop environment.

    TeamViewer

    TeamViewer offers a user-friendly interface for remote access. It supports both command-line and graphical access, making it a versatile option.
